The Basics of Off-Grid Solar Systems

Off-grid solar systems are designed to provide electricity to homes and structures that are not connected to the traditional power grid. These systems consist of a few key components:

  • Solar Panels: Solar panels capture sunlight and convert it into electricity. They are typically mounted on rooftops or in clear areas with maximum sun exposure.
  • Charge Controller: The charge controller regulates the voltage and current coming from the solar panels to ensure that the batteries are charged safely and efficiently.
  • Battery Bank: Energy generated by the solar panels is stored in a battery bank for use during periods of low or no sunlight.
  • Inverter: The inverter converts the direct current (DC) electricity from the batteries into alternating current (AC) electricity, which is what most home appliances and devices use.
  • Backup Generator (Optional): Some off-grid setups include a backup generator powered by fossil fuels or propane to provide electricity during extended cloudy periods or high energy demand.

Sizing Your Off-Grid Solar System

Properly sizing your off-grid solar system is essential to meeting your energy needs. This requires careful consideration of your power consumption. Start by listing all the appliances and devices you plan to use and their respective power ratings. Then, calculate the total energy consumption in watt-hours per day. This information will help you determine the number of solar panels, battery capacity, and inverter size required for your system.

Energy Storage: The Role of Batteries

One of the critical aspects of off-grid living is energy storage. Batteries are used to store excess energy generated by the solar panels during the day for use at night or during cloudy days. Several types of batteries can be used in off-grid solar systems, including lead-acid, lithium-ion, and flow batteries.

Lithium-ion batteries, while more expensive upfront, are becoming increasingly popular for off-grid applications due to their high energy density, longer lifespan, and ability to provide a steady power supply.

Maintenance and Monitoring

Proper maintenance is essential for the longevity and efficiency of your off-grid solar system. Regularly cleaning your solar panels, checking the battery bank, and inspecting electrical connections will help ensure your system continues to function optimally. Additionally, monitoring the performance of your system and battery levels can help you make informed decisions about energy usage.

Challenges of Off-Grid Solar Living

While off-grid living offers many benefits, it also comes with its own set of challenges:

  • Initial Costs: Setting up an off-grid solar system can be expensive, including the cost of solar panels, batteries, and inverters. However, it’s essential to view this as an investment that will pay off in the long run through energy savings and independence.
  • Limited Energy Storage: The capacity of your battery bank will determine how long you can go without sunlight. During extended periods of cloudy weather, it may be necessary to ration energy use or have backup generators on hand.
  • Energy Consumption Management: You must become conscious of your energy consumption and adjust your lifestyle to make the most of the energy available.
  • Equipment Maintenance: Regular maintenance of the solar panels, batteries, and other components is necessary to ensure they operate efficiently and have a long lifespan.
  • Energy Source Variability: Energy production depends on weather conditions and the season. You may have to adjust your energy use during times of limited sunlight.
  • Isolation: Off-grid living can be isolating, especially if you are in a remote area. It’s essential to be mentally prepared for the challenges of isolation and have strategies for staying connected to the outside world.
